In modern Caribbean culture, there is a mermaid recognized as a Haitian vodou loa called La Sirene (lit. "the mermaid"), representing wealth, beauty and the orisha Yemaya. WebSep 23, 2024 · La Sirène – literally “the mermaid” in French – is the Haitian incarnation of water spirits from the African diaspora, drawing on the traditional mythology of Mami Wata. The person willing to tell the story shouts out: KRIK. If people want to hear the tale, and they nearly always do, they answer in chorus: KRAK. The most popular folk tales concern the smart, but mischievous Ti Malice and his very slow-witted friend Bouki.
